Abstract
A voltage supply circuit capable of starting up a system while maintaining symmetry of a high level selection signal VH and a low level selection signal VL, not requiring a multistage charge pump circuit, and capable of reducing the number of parts of the system, wherein generation circuits of VD and VH are comprised of chopper type booster type switching regulators, and switching timings of a VH generation circuit 12 and a VL generation circuit 13 are controlled so that a virtual reference voltage VS (VD/2) and a middle point potential between VH and VL become the same.
